Output 72680bb6a35ca24ad363465356c59071bf7c7f6cb6894719eb54d79fcd703397:1

value
10610979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 215b50f6a8ec438c9ff2db1d34dc509cbfdce14c OP_EQUAL
address
34jPce3AsyqYxpKAtPXtMQFzQHrTTwAhQk
transaction
72680bb6a35ca24ad363465356c59071bf7c7f6cb6894719eb54d79fcd703397
confirmations
406999
spent
true